Product Description

Product Description

"The Electrician's Guide to Emergency Lighting" is one of a number of publications prepared by the IET to provide guidance on electrical installations in buildings. This publication is concerned with emergency lighting and in particular emergency escape lighting and must be read in conjunction with legislation: Approved Document B, and the British Standards, in particular "BS 5266".


About the Author

Paul Cook CEng FIEE was the Principal Engineer in the Technical Regulations department of the IEE. For many years he was closely involved in the preparation of the IEE Wiring Regulations BS 7671 and related publications. He has wide experience of electrical contracting in various roles from design engineer to business manager.
